Srinagar

Life returned to normal in Shopian district of south Kashmir on Tuesday after a complete shutdown for ten consecutive days against the killing of 13 militants and five civilians in Kashmir valley.

Reports said that shops and business establishments opened across the district and both private and public transport was on roads.

A large number of people were seen busy in purchasing different household items from the market.

Local sources said that there was no major deployment of police and paramilitary troopers in the township.
